Description and Requirements About the PositionLenovo's Cloud Service Provider (CSP) organization is seeking an exceptional executive sales leader to serve as Director, AI Cloud Sales
- North America. In this role, you will take ownership of a multi-billion dollar territory, steering the sales strategy, client alignment, and revenue execution across a premier portfolio of North American AI Cloud customers. This portfolio spans NA AI Cloud customers mainly neoclouds focused on GPU-as-a-Service. You will directly lead a dedicated team of Senior Account Executives driving core Compute and Storage-heavy business, taking end-to-end accountability for overall account strategy, complex demand planning, pricing models, and the seamless execution of large-scale, custom infrastructure deployments.
This position is based in the San Francisco Bay area and will have PST business hours. Traveling for this role will be at 50%.
